免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何自己开发一个app软件

开发一个APP软件需要经历如下步骤:

1.确定APP的目标用户和功能

在开始开发APP之前,你需要明确APP的目标用户和功能。你需要了解你的用户喜欢什么样的APP,他们需要什么样的功能,这样才能确定你的APP的功能和用户界面。

2.选择开发平台和工具

选择适合自己的开发平台和工具非常重要。例如,如果你是一个iOS开发者,那么你需要用Xcode和Swift/Objective-C来开发你的APP。如果你是一个Android开发者,那么你需要用Android Studio和Java/Kotlin来开发你的APP。

3.设计APP的用户界面和流程

APP的用户界面和流程设计非常重要,因为它们直接影响用户的使用体验。你需要设计一个简洁明了、易于使用、美观大方的用户界面,同时要保证APP的流程清晰,用户能够轻松地完成所需操作。

4.编写APP的代码

在APP的设计完成之后,你需要编写代码来实现它的功能。在编写代码的过程中,你需要注重代码的可读性、可维护性和可扩展性,同时要遵守编程规范和良好的编程习惯。

5.测试APP的功能和稳定性

在APP的开发过程中,你需要进行测试来确保APP的功能和稳定性。你需要测试APP在不同设备上的表现,发现并修复任何可能存在的问题,确保APP的质量。

6.发布APP

最后,当你的APP已经完成开发和测试之后,你需要发布它。你需要在应用商店上发布你的APP,例如苹果商店或Google Play商店。同时,你也需要在社交媒体上宣传你的APP,吸引更多的用户下载和使用。

以上是开发一个APP的基本步骤,当然在实际开发过程中还有许多细节需要注意。如果你是一名初学者,可以从简单的APP入手,逐渐提高自己的开发水平。


相关知识:
k11商城预约系统app开发
K11商城预约系统App是一款致力于提供个性化预约服务的应用程序。它基于移动互联网技术,通过用户个人手机号码和身份信息进行注册和登录。用户可以选择商城中的特定商品或服务,并预约到具体的日期和时间进行购买或享受服务。下面将详细介绍K11商城预约系统App的开
2023-07-14
app自助开发官网
App自助开发官网,也被称为Low-Code开发平台,是一种可以快速构建应用程序的软件开发工具。它提供了一个友好的界面,通过拖拽和配置的方式,使用户能够快速创建移动应用程序,而无需编写复杂的代码。在传统的软件开发中,开发人员需要具备深厚的编程知识和技能,才
2023-07-14
app研发开发语言用的是什么
移动应用程序(App)的开发语言可以根据平台的不同而异。以下将为您介绍一些主要的移动应用开发语言,包括其原理和详细介绍。1. Java:Java是一种用途广泛的编程语言,被广泛用于开发Android平台上的应用程序。Java具有跨平台的特性,也就是说可以在
2023-07-14
app开发需求如何整理
在进行app开发之前,整理需求是非常重要的一步。只有清晰明确的需求,才能确保开发过程顺利进行,并最终满足用户的期望。下面是一些整理app开发需求的方法和步骤。1.明确目标和目的:首先,明确开发这个app的目标和目的是什么。是为了提供某种服务,还是为了解决某
2023-06-29
app开发步骤有哪些
App开发指的是开发和设计适用于各类移动设备(如手机和平板等)上运行的应用程序。移动应用开发分为两大类:原生App开发和混合App开发。原生App开发专指为特定平台(例如Android或iOS)开发应用程序,要使用各个平台的开发工具和语言。而混合App开发
2023-06-29
android的app开发环境搭建
Android是当前世界上最受欢迎的移动操作系统之一。该操作系统凭借着其开源、高可用,开发者友好等特点成为了众多企业和开发者的首选。为了让您快速入门,本文将带您了解Android开发环境的搭建方法。一、Windows平台下的开发环境搭建1.下载和安装JDK
2023-05-06